A double iced shaken espresso contains 8 calories per 100 g. It provides 1.4 g of carbohydrates, 0.3 g of protein, and 0.1 g of fat per 100 g.
Double iced shaken espresso has a glycemic index of 15, which is low. It contains 1.4 g of carbohydrates per 100 g and is compatible with vegan, vegetarian, paleo, gluten-free, Mediterranean, and flexitarian diets.
